General Information about Evening Sea
The hexadecimal color code #0B4A4C, also known as Evening Sea, is a dark shade of cyan. It is composed of 4.31% red, 29.02% green, and 29.8% blue. In the RGB color model, #0B4A4C consists of 4.31 red, 29.02 green, and 29.8 blue. In a CMYK color space, it is composed of 85.5% cyan, 2.7% magenta, 0% yellow, and 70.2% black. Its dark nature makes it more appropriate for backgrounds or elements where a subtle visual impact is desired. The color #0B4A4C, also known as Evening Sea, presents some accessibility considerations for web development. Its relatively low lightness value means it may not provide sufficient contrast with white text or backgrounds, potentially causing readability issues for users with visual impairments. According to WCAG guidelines, a contrast ratio of at least 4.5:1 is recommended for normal text and 3:1 for large text. Testing the color combination with accessibility tools is crucial to ensure compliance. When used for interactive elements, such as buttons or links, sufficient visual cues beyond color alone should be provided. Using alternative indicators, such as underlines or icons, will help enhance usability for color-blind users. Careful consideration of font size and weight can also mitigate some contrast issues. Web Design
In web design, #0B4A4C can be used for website headers or footers to create a professional and calming atmosphere. Its dark hue makes it suitable for backgrounds paired with lighter text for optimal readability. It's also effective for highlighting call-to-action buttons when complemented with an accent color. In data visualization, this color can represent a specific category within charts and graphs, ensuring a sophisticated and clear representation of information. Interior Design
In interior design, #0B4A4C can create a relaxing and sophisticated atmosphere. It can be used as an accent wall color in living rooms or bedrooms, complemented by lighter furniture and decor. It is also suitable for cabinetry in kitchens or bathrooms, creating a modern and elegant look. This color pairs well with natural materials such as wood and stone, enhancing the sense of tranquility. Consider using it in combination with metallic accents like gold or copper for a touch of luxury.
